Brahm Bhardwaj (25 October 1920 — 29 July 1989) was an Indian actor of Hindi cinema. Mostly known for his role as a father of leading actors and as Judge or Lawyer. Filmography
Brahm Bhardwaj is a supporting actor with more than 200 films to his credit, in the course of a career spanning approximately 40 years. He left his mark with his charismatic personality, skill in dialogue delivery, and acting skills.
